For gaming, the i7 is a bit much, but if you have the budget it's fine. You may get more out of the system with an i5 instead and using the money on a 1080, although you may want to check out some benchmarks for CPUs if the 1080 can be bottlenecked by the i5.

I would also go with a larger SSD drive so you can load more games on it, a 512 is good. No sense in spending a ton on a computer and then running out of space on the SSD to load programs off. I would just use the standard drive for storing a backup image and files, not to install programs on.
